What Type of Medicine is Creston?

Creston is a synthetic, prescription medication whose active ingredient is the international non-proprietary name (INN) compound, Rosuvastatin. This substance is categorized within the drug class known as statins, which are formally identified as hydroxymethylglutaryl-coenzyme A (HMG-CoA) reductase inhibitors. Rosuvastatin Calcium, its specific form, is a completely laboratory-synthesized compound, distinguishing it structurally from naturally derived substances. As a hypolipidemic agent, Rosuvastatin is clinically recognized for its high potency compared to some older statins. This confirms the medicine's primary role as a tool for achieving significant adjustments in blood fat levels.


Composition, Form, and General Purpose

The medication is a single-ingredient product, containing only the Rosuvastatin Calcium active substance alongside solid pharmaceutical excipients used to form the tablet matrix. Creston is delivered as an oral dosage form, specifically a film-coated tablet. The primary, high-level purpose of this medication is to serve as a potent lipid-modifying agent designed to help manage and improve the patient’s overall blood lipid profile. This is achieved by the competitive inhibition of the HMG-CoA reductase enzyme, which in turn reduces the liver’s production of cholesterol. A typical neutral use scenario for Creston is the management of elevated cholesterol in adults, a therapeutic approach supported by clinical trials. This core systemic action is vital for regulating the balance of fats in the bloodstream, particularly the reduction of low-density lipoprotein cholesterol (LDL-C).

What side effects are possible with Creston?

Possible Side Effects and Safety Information

The safety profile of rosuvastatin (Crestor) is characterized by a risk of serious muscle and liver adverse reactions, alongside common but generally mild side effects reported in clinical trials.

Serious and Clinically Significant Adverse Reactions

Rosuvastatin is associated with skeletal muscle effects, including myopathy (muscle pain, tenderness, or weakness) and, rarely, rhabdomyolysis, a severe form of muscle breakdown that can lead to acute renal (kidney) failure. The risk of these muscle disorders is known to increase with the highest 40 mg dose, advanced age (65 or older), hypothyroidism, renal impairment, and the use of certain interacting medications.

  • Liver Dysfunction: Persistent elevations in liver enzymes have been reported, and rare cases of fatal and non-fatal hepatic failure have occurred. The drug is contraindicated in individuals with active liver disease or unexplained persistent elevations of serum transaminases. Liver enzyme testing is recommended before starting therapy.
  • Metabolic Effects: Increases in blood glucose (sugar) levels and HbA1c have been observed, leading to an increased risk of new-onset diabetes mellitus, particularly in the 40 mg dose group.

Common Adverse Reactions

The most frequent adverse reactions reported in clinical trials (occurring in ge2% of patients and at a rate greater than placebo) include:

  • Headache
  • Nausea
  • Myalgia (muscle ache)
  • Asthenia (weakness)
  • Constipation

Population-Specific Safety Considerations and Restrictions

Rosuvastatin is contraindicated for use in pregnant women as it may cause fetal harm, and in nursing mothers. Women of childbearing potential are advised to use effective contraception during treatment.

Patients of Asian descent may have higher systemic drug exposure, and a lower starting dose is recommended for this population. Caution and potential dose adjustment are also required for individuals with severe renal impairment.

Overdose and Emergency Response

Overdose and when to seek help

The official regulatory documentation for Rosuvastatin (Creston) provides specific guidance regarding excessive exposure. No unique pattern of signs or symptoms for acute overdose is described; instead, documented manifestations relate to known dose-dependent toxicities, primarily affecting the musculoskeletal and hepatic systems.


Severe Outcomes and Required Action

The most serious outcome officially associated with overdose is the potential for Rhabdomyolysis (severe muscle breakdown), which carries a risk for subsequent renal dysfunction. Immediate medical attention must be sought, or emergency services contacted, in the event of a known overdose. This action is also mandated if unexplained muscle pain, tenderness, or weakness develops, as these are signs of potential severe toxicity.

Overdose Management Statement Regulatory Stance
Specific Antidote No specific antidote is available for Rosuvastatin overdose.
Treatment Approach Management is limited to symptomatic and supportive treatment.
Monitoring Mandate Continuous monitoring of creatine kinase (CK) levels and liver function tests (transaminases) is required to assess the extent of injury.
Dialysis Efficacy Hemodialysis does not significantly enhance drug clearance.

The required emergency response is dictated by the absence of an antidote and the severe, officially documented risk of Rhabdomyolysis. Due to these constraints, regulatory documents mandate seeking urgent medical help and initiating a monitoring protocol based on CK and transaminase laboratory findings to manage these specific, life-threatening complications.

Therapeutic Uses of Creston

What Creston Treats: Main Uses and Benefits

Creston (Rosuvastatin) is a lipid-modifying medication used for the long-term management of cardiovascular risk factors, generally applied for chronic, asymptomatic biochemical imbalances. It primarily addresses Asymptomatic Lipid Imbalance, which covers high levels of Low-Density Lipoprotein Cholesterol (LDL-C) and triglycerides.

Creston is indicated as an adjunct to diet when non-pharmacological responses are inadequate for conditions such as primary hypercholesterolaemia (Type IIa) or mixed dyslipidaemia (Type IIb). The medication helps address the systemic imbalance by correcting these laboratory-measured levels.

Clinical scenarios involve primary and secondary prevention strategies for serious cardiovascular complications in at-risk individuals, and management of inherited conditions such as Familial Hypercholesterolemia (HeFH and HoFH). The therapy supports the patient by assisting with the management of long-term cardiovascular changes and contributes to lowering the overall cardiovascular risk profile over time.

Eligibility and Restrictions for Use

Eligibility Scope

Category Status/Rule (Based on official labeling)
Populations for whom use is allowed Adults; Pediatric patients ge 7 years old (for HoFH); Pediatric patients ge 8 years old (for HeFH).
Populations for whom use is not recommended Women who are breastfeeding; Pediatric patients under 7 years; Patients with moderate hepatic impairment (Child-Pugh 7–9 in some regions).
Populations for whom use is contraindicated Patients with known hypersensitivity to any component; Active liver disease (including unexplained persistent elevations of serum transaminases > 3 imes ULN); Pregnancy and Lactation; Severe renal impairment (creatinine clearance < 30 mL/min in some regions); Patients with myopathy (in some regions).

Eligibility Classifications

Official regulatory documents classify use in certain populations as contraindicated, representing absolute exclusions based on physiological status, organ function, or hypersensitivity. This includes patients with active liver disease and women who are or may become pregnant or are breastfeeding.

Eligibility-Related Restrictions

Age-specific eligibility is documented for pediatric use, with minimum ages of 7 or 8 years depending on the specific condition, thereby excluding younger children. Additionally, the highest dose (40 mg) is subject to specific regional contraindications, such as in patients with moderate renal impairment or certain pre-disposing factors for muscle disorders.

What should I know about interactions with other medicines?

Interactions with other medicines and products

Creston (rosuvastatin) interacts with other substances primarily by affecting its systemic exposure, which is regulated by specific drug transporters. Co-administration of certain medicines is subject to formal restrictions documented in regulatory labeling.


Key Interaction Classifications

Interaction Type Interacting Substance/Class Official Regulatory Status
Contraindicated Combination Cyclosporine Prohibited due to a large increase in plasma concentration.
Pharmacodynamic Risk Fibrates (e.g., Gemfibrozil) Increases the risk of adverse skeletal muscle effects.
Exposure Modification Antiviral Agents (e.g., Lopinavir/Ritonavir) Requires rosuvastatin dose limitation due to increased exposure.

Specific Interaction Constraints

The primary mechanism involves transporter inhibition, specifically of the OATP1B1 and BCRP proteins, by co-administered medicines, which results in elevated rosuvastatin levels. When co-administered with Coumarin anticoagulants (e.g., Warfarin), monitoring of the International Normalized Ratio (INR) is required due to the effect on anticoagulation. Rosuvastatin absorption is reduced by Aluminum and Magnesium Hydroxide Antacids; regulatory documents mandate that rosuvastatin must be administered at least two hours after these antacids. Caution is also noted for Asian patients, where naturally increased plasma concentrations require a lower starting dose recommendation.

Mechanism of Action

Targeted Blockade of Hepatic Cholesterol Production

The drug's primary mechanism involves the competitive and reversible inhibition of HMG-CoA reductase (HMGCR) , the rate-limiting enzyme in the liver's Mevalonate pathway. This action restricts the internal synthesis of cholesterol within liver cells, initiating the condition of lowered intracellular cholesterol concentration.


Enhanced Clearance of Circulating Cholesterol

In response to the lowered concentration, the liver compensates by increasing the expression of Low-Density Lipoprotein (LDL) receptors on its surface. The increase in these active receptors enhances the organ's capacity to capture and metabolize LDL-C particles from the bloodstream, leading to a net decrease in plasma LDL-C concentration.


Non-Lipid Modulation of Vascular Signaling

Beyond the main lipid effects, inhibition of HMGCR also reduces the production of non-sterol intermediates (isoprenoids). This secondary, or pleiotropic, mechanism modulates cellular signaling essential for blood vessel dynamics, influencing pathways associated with endothelial function and the modulation of certain inflammatory markers.

Dosage and Administration Information

How to Use Creston: Administration Guidelines

Rosuvastatin (Creston) is administered as a single oral dose in the form of a film-coated tablet that must be swallowed whole. This administration can occur at any time of day and is independent of meals, meaning it can be taken with or without food.


Dosing and Titration

Therapy generally follows a long-term, chronic pattern. The typical starting dose for adults is 10 mg or 20 mg once daily. Dosage adjustments, or titration, are a key procedural step and are recommended at intervals of 2 to 4 weeks following the analysis of lipid levels. The maintenance dosage range is 5 mg to 40 mg once daily, with the maximum recommended daily dose set at 40 mg. This maximum dose is reserved only for patients who have not achieved their therapeutic goal on the 20 mg dose.


Population-Specific Use Rules

Specific dosage limits apply to certain groups. Patients with severe renal impairment (not on hemodialysis) should be initiated on the lowest dose, 5 mg, and should not exceed 10 mg once daily. Additionally, a starting dose of 5 mg is specified for patients of Asian descent. Dosing for children and adolescents with Heterozygous Familial Hypercholesterolemia (HeFH) is defined by age, with a daily range between 5 mg and 20 mg.

If a dose is missed, the standard procedure is taking the next dose at the regular scheduled time and not taking two doses to make up for the missed one.

Frequently Asked Questions (FAQ)

Common questions about Creston (FAQ)

Q: How quickly should I expect to feel the effects of Creston?

A: Official information indicates that the drug begins to affect your body’s lipid levels within approximately one week of starting treatment. Studies show that the maximum therapeutic response for adjusting cholesterol levels is generally achieved by the end of the first month of consistent use.

Q: If I miss a dose of Creston, what is the generally accepted advice?

A: Regulatory guidance suggests taking the missed dose as soon as it is remembered. However, if it is almost time for your next scheduled dose, regulatory guidance advises taking only the next usual dose. It is advised not to take two doses at the same time to compensate for the missed one.

Q: Are there any long-term health concerns associated with using Creston?

A: The official product literature, based on both short-term and long-term clinical trials, describes the established risk factors associated with the chronic use of statins. Long-term warnings primarily concern muscle and liver issues, as well as the potential for an increased blood sugar/diabetes risk over time.

Q: Can Creston cause changes in weight?

A: Weight change is not listed as one of the common or serious adverse reactions in the official prescribing information. The documents primarily focus on metabolic effects, such as changes in blood glucose (sugar) levels, which are related to the body's metabolism.

Q: How does the drug stay in the body after I stop taking it?

A: Pharmacokinetic data from regulatory filings show that the drug has an elimination half-life of approximately 19 hours. This means it takes about that long for the concentration of the drug in the bloodstream to be reduced by half. The medication is primarily eliminated from the body via feces.

Q: Is there a generic version of Creston available?

A: Yes, regulatory bodies, such as the FDA, have approved generic versions of the active ingredient, rosuvastatin calcium. The generic product is deemed bioequivalent to the brand-name medication.

Q: Can Creston be taken with supplements like multivitamins or herbal remedies?

A: Official documents advise caution with certain substances, such as niacin (Vitamin B3) and list fibrates due to the potential for increased risk of muscle problems. Some herbal remedies, such as St. John's wort, are also known to potentially affect how the body processes the medication.

Q: Is it true that Creston can affect sleep patterns?

A: Regulatory summaries and post-marketing data reports have included sleep disorders, such as insomnia (difficulty sleeping), among the possible psychiatric adverse effects. This effect is noted with unknown frequency and remains a subject of research.

Q: Can Creston make me feel tired or affect my ability to drive?

A: The common adverse reaction Asthenia (weakness) is listed in official documents. Official information sometimes states that if dizziness or similar symptoms occur, activities requiring focused attention, such as driving, are generally advised against.

Q: Why are there so many warnings about grapefruit juice and Creston?

A: Grapefruit juice interacts with an enzyme that breaks down many other statin drugs. However, the official documents for rosuvastatin indicate the drug is not primarily metabolized by that enzyme system. Therefore, the specific contraindications regarding grapefruit juice found on the labels of some other statin drugs are not present in the official documents for rosuvastatin.

Q: Does Creston affect the effectiveness of birth control pills?

A: Studies show that co-administration may increase the plasma concentrations of certain hormones found in oral contraceptives. The official product information describes that women of childbearing potential are advised to use contraception, though the clinical significance of these hormone level changes is officially listed as unknown.

Q: Why is Creston prescribed to people who don't have the main illness it's advertised for?

A: The drug is formally indicated for regulating lipids and reducing cardiovascular risks. Regulatory documents explain that the drug’s mechanism includes secondary, non-lipid effects—such as influencing blood vessel function and inflammation—which are the subject of ongoing clinical exploration for applications beyond its primary indication.

Q: Does Creston cause dry mouth or frequent thirst?

A: Dry mouth and increased thirst are occasionally noted among the less common side effects reported in clinical trials or post-marketing surveillance. These are not listed among the most frequently observed adverse events.

Q: What are the known potential interactions between Creston and common allergy medications?

A: Official regulatory labeling provides constraints for major interacting drug classes, such as Fibrates and Cyclosporine. Common allergy medications (antihistamines) are not listed in the documents as a major interaction requiring dose adjustment or formal contraindication.

Q: Can Creston be crushed or split if it is difficult to swallow?

A: The drug is a film-coated tablet that the official instructions in the prescribing information state must be swallowed whole. Because the tablet is film-coated, regulatory instructions state it must not be crushed, dissolved, or chewed.

Q: Is it normal for side effects to be worse when first starting Creston?

A: Regulatory documents confirm that adverse events are tracked in both short-term and long-term trials. Patient information sometimes explains that common side effects, such as muscle aches, are often reported relatively soon after beginning treatment.

Q: What is the difference between the low dose and high dose of Creston?

A: Doses range from 5 mg up to 40 mg. The maximum 40 mg dose is reserved for patients who need additional therapeutic adjustment. Regulatory documents explicitly state that the risk of serious side effects (muscle and metabolic effects) is known to increase with the highest dose (40 mg) compared to lower doses.

Q: What are the general expectations about the drug's effect when taking it with or without food?

A: Regulatory documents specify that the drug may be taken with or without food and at any time of day. This indicates that food intake is not considered a clinically significant factor that changes how the drug is absorbed or how effectively it works.

Q: Is Creston safe for people who have a history of seizures?

A: The official product information lists specific conditions that may increase the risk of muscle problems (myopathy/rhabdomyolysis). However, the documents do not list seizures or epilepsy as a specific contraindication or a pre-disposing factor in its official warnings.

How should Creston be stored and disposed of?

How to Store and Dispose of CRESTOR (Rosuvastatin)

Official regulatory documents define strict conditions for the storage and disposal of CRESTOR tablets to maintain product quality and safety.

Storage Requirements

CRESTOR must be stored at Controlled Room Temperature, which is officially defined as 20 C to 25 C (68 F to 77 F), with permitted temperature variations (excursions) up to 30 C. The medication is required to be protected from moisture and must be kept out of the reach of children.

Disposal Instructions

Unused or expired CRESTOR should be disposed of in accordance with local regulations, often through an official drug take-back program. The product must not be disposed of via wastewater or routine household trash, as specified by some regulatory agencies. When a take-back program is unavailable, US FDA guidelines recommend mixing the product with an undesirable substance, such as dirt or used coffee grounds, placing it in a sealed bag, and discarding it in the household trash.
